The 19th Annotation of the Exercises, so labeled by Ignatius, is a retreat in daily life that consists of an eight-month program of prayer following a pattern of meditation, contemplation, and scripture reading. 

Through this experience, retreatants come to a greater awareness of God's presence in their lives.
